About Peppercorn Pizza

Peppercorn Pizza turns out hefty, old-school deep pan pies loaded edge to edge with generous, distinct toppings. Regulars across Doncaster East count on these weighty boxes to feed a crowd—where thick bacon strips, marinara seafood, and bubbly cheese hold firm over a sturdy crust with zero undercarriage flop. For weekend gatherings, the kitchen easily portions family trays into party cuts like diamond slices or bite-sized squares for effortless sharing.

  • Hefty Deep Pan Crusts: Old-school thick crusts stand up to generous layers of cheese, sauce, and un-fused toppings without losing their crunch.
  • Bespoke Party Cuts: Family-sized takeaway orders can be customized into finger-food diamond cuts or bite-sized squares for hosting crowds.
  • Decades-Long Neighborhood Fixture: Neighborhood patrons have relied on the kitchen for over thirty years for consistent takeaway portions and warm counter service.

Before you head over

Practical ordering advice for a smooth takeaway experience at Peppercorn Pizza.

  • Call Early During Peak Hours

    Phone lines can get extremely busy or disconnect during peak evening rushes, so try calling well in advance of dinner or be prepared for redials when placing takeaway orders.

  • Request Custom Party Cuts

    If hosting a gathering or catering finger food, request custom cuts like diamond or square slices when ordering your family-sized pizzas for easier serving.

  • Opt for Deep Pan Crust

    When craving a hearty, substantial crust, opt specifically for the deep pan style, which provides a thick, flavorful base that holds up to heavy toppings.
